Here are some common carpentry testing tools you might consider:
  • Measuring Tape: Essential for taking accurate measurements of wood and spaces.
  • Square: Used to check and mark right angles, ensuring cuts are precise.
  • Level: Ensures that surfaces are perfectly horizontal or vertical.
  • Caliper: Ideal for measuring the thickness of materials and ensuring they fit together correctly.
  • Moisture Meter: Helps determine the moisture content of wood, which is crucial for quality.
